For the past twenty years every time I see John at a gun show he says " I'm going to get out those Heisers and bring them to you." Over the years he has brought a few and we've come to terms on them. Last week he brought a tub full and I came home with four.
This one is a model 181 holster made for a Savage .32 auto. The model number is shown in catalog number 14 and not in number 19-the 400, 500 and 700 series model numbers appear in number 19. This is a special order holster as number 181 is described as a waffle stamped holster with a snap button closure and sewn seam, this example is basket weave, rawhide edge laced and has a finial closure. The belt loop is riveted and sewn, the leather is stiff, the edge lacing is sound and I have my father in law's Savage to go in it.
